## Service account: Fixturesmith

Fixturesmith is the test-data factory library used by the support sandbox to generate realistic-looking customer records on demand. It runs under a dedicated service account with write access limited to the sandbox schemas only. When reproducing a customer issue, support staff authenticate the seeding client with the shared service key, which is provided immediately below this line.

API key for yahig-tadup: kto7_ubizbYm

Subject: Circuit breaker rollout for the Fernhollow upstream API

Hi team,

We've enabled a circuit breaker on all calls to the Fernhollow quoting endpoint. It opens after five consecutive 5xx responses, holds for thirty seconds, then half-opens with a single probe. Please mirror these thresholds on your side so retries stay aligned.

For verification calls against our sandbox, use the bearer token below.

session JWT of yawep-yawep = eyJhbGciOiJIUzI1NiIsInR5cCI6IkpXVCJ9.eyJzdWIiOiI3pWF3_In0.aXYsHiog

Caching invalidation for the Ferrowind product catalog deserves careful attention during releases. Price and stock edits publish invalidation events to the Quillbus queue; each edge node must acknowledge before the release gate clears. If acknowledgements stall past two minutes, do not force the deploy — stale SKUs will surface in search. Instead, verify the invalidation ledger directly. The ledger lives in the catalog database, reached with the connection below.

replica DSN, kajep-yahag: mssql://praok_svc:iF@db-8d68.plorvaio.local:5432/eliion